My review of Joanna Nascimento's ethnography, Working the Fabric, is now out in @saw-anthroofwork.bsky.social Exertions. For those interested in the people and processes that make one of fashion's most iconic textiles, Harris Tweed, this book is for you! saw.americananthro.org/pub/li5yuag7...
Book Review: Working the Fabric
Book review of Joanna Nascimento's Working the Fabric: Resourcefulness, Belonging and Island Life in Scotland’s Harris Tweed Industry (2023)

Hi #anthrosky. Is anyone going to Tampa this week for #AAA2024? If you are, I'd love to see you at my panel: Making as Ethnographic Praxis. We'll be sharing papers on craft-making as ethnographic practice and are delighted to have Cristina Grasseni as our discussant.
Inforgraphic displaying information about Making As Ethnogrphric Praxis panel at #AAATAMPA2024. The panel is occurring on WEDNESDAY NOVEMBER 20th from 4:15 PM-5:45 PM in TCC 120
